Precisely three weeks ago, World No. 9 Holger Rune suffered a haunting opening round exit from Wimbledon after being up by two sets. On Tuesday, the Danish sensation will look to return to winning ways at the 2025 Mubadala Citi DC Open against Alexandre Muller of France. The Round of 32 clash will determine who progresses to the pre-quarterfinals, to face either Alex Michelsen or Daniel Evans. Rune and Muller will be squaring off for the first time on the ATP Tour. In April, the 22-year-old prodigy made headlines when he beat Carlos Alcaraz to win the Barcelona Open trophy. Apart from this, Rune also made the final at Indian Wells. On the other hand, his French counterpart has lost his last four opening round contests coming into this match. He began the year with a title in Hong Kong, followed by a runner-up finish at Rio in February.
The 28-year-old Muller has a forgettable 1-4 record on hard courts this year. He wins 69% service games on this surface, and 15% return games. Rune, who recently stated his desire to become World No. 1, has 10 wins out of 15 hard court encounters this year. With no points to defend at this tournament, the former Top-5 starlet will be on a mission to make the most of his free swing on American soil.
